What WorkCover and TAC physiotherapy involves

Whether your injury is covered under Victorian WorkCover or the Transport Accident Commission (TAC), the physiotherapy process follows a similar structure: thorough assessment, evidence-based treatment, and regular reporting that supports your ongoing claim.

How we support your claim and recovery

  1. Thorough assessment and evidence-based treatment, addressing your specific injury from lifting-related strains to transport accident trauma
  2. Clear, regular reporting to your case manager or insurer, so your claim keeps moving without unnecessary delays
  3. Collaborative return-to-work planning with your employer, including graded duties where clinically appropriate
  4. Communication with your treating doctor throughout recovery, keeping your entire care team aligned

Why early, well-coordinated care matters

Physiotherapy after a workplace injury is associated with faster return to work and reduced risk of long-term disability, particularly when care begins promptly. Research also shows psychosocial factors — stress, uncertainty about the claims process, workplace relationships — can account for a significant proportion of unnecessary work disability, which is why clear communication throughout your recovery is as much a part of our job as the physical treatment itself.

Questions about WorkCover and TAC Physiotherapy

Do I need to pay upfront for WorkCover or TAC physiotherapy?

In most approved claims, treatment is billed directly to your WorkCover or TAC insurer. We'll help clarify your specific situation at your first visit, including what happens if your claim is still being assessed.

Will you help with my return-to-work plan?

Yes, we work closely with your employer, case manager, and treating doctor to develop realistic, safe return-to-work plans, including graded or modified duties where appropriate.

What if my claim hasn't been approved yet?

Get in touch with our team — we can talk through your options while your claim is being processed, since early assessment and treatment is generally associated with better recovery outcomes.

Why is communication with my employer so important?

Research on workplace injury recovery shows psychosocial factors — including workplace relationships and clarity around expectations — significantly influence recovery time and return-to-work success. Clear, three-way communication between you, us, and your employer helps prevent unnecessary delays and misunderstandings.

Do I get to choose my own physiotherapist for a WorkCover or TAC claim?

In Victoria, you generally have the right to choose your treating physiotherapist under both WorkCover and TAC schemes — you're not required to use a provider nominated by your employer or insurer.

What happens if my recovery is taking longer than expected?

We'll reassess and adjust your plan, and communicate clearly with your case manager about realistic timelines. Longer recovery doesn't necessarily mean something's wrong — some injuries genuinely take more time, and keeping your claim's paperwork aligned with your actual progress matters as much as the treatment itself.
